Problem:
I have a traffic light logic in my model (which is working fine) - now I like to match this logic with the dates from the Logic Table (Start and End).
I build a measure for this too but this won't work like I like :).
For example If I have choose the 03/03/2021 then the color should change to green (because if we go into the Logic Table the values between 01/01/2021 and 30/06/2021 should be green if its under 0,9
If I choose the 07/07/2021 then the color should change into orange because we have a new range in the Logic table from 01/07/2021 to 03/03/2022 which says that every values over 0,5 should be orange

Hi @KBO ,
I have first cleaned up the relationships a bit.
After that I created the following measure for formatting. I hope it helps.
TL =
VAR _Logic =
FILTER (
Logic,
Logic[Start] <= SELECTEDVALUE ( 'Date'[End of Month] )
&& Logic[End] >= SELECTEDVALUE ( 'Date'[End of Month] )
)
VAR _Value = [Total Values]
RETURN
MAXX (
_Logic,
SWITCH (
TRUE (),
_Value < [Green ], "green",
_Value <= [Yellow], "orange",
_Value > [Red], "red",
"grey"
)
)
